ABSTRACT

An experimental study was conducted by using quasi experimental

pre- test post- test control group design to evaluate the effectiveness of Buerger

Allen exercise to promote wound healing process among type2 diabetic patients

with foot ulcer. The tool used for this study consists of demographic profile,

medical related information, Wagner wound assessment scale and wound

assessment check list. The population of this study was 60 diabetic patients with

foot ulcer of both the sex, 30 for experimental group, and 30 for control group.

Sample for the study were selected by using non probability purposive sampling

technique. Conceptual framework used for the study was based on Modified

Orem’s Theory of Self care deficit. Along with the routine treatment, Buerger

Allen exercise was performed to experimental group and routine treatment was

given to the control group. The diabetic foot ulcer was assessed with wound

assessment check list before and after the intervention. The findings of the

study revealed that in Experimental group 24.6 % and in Control group 5.3 %

are showing improvement in wound healing process. It shows the effectiveness

of study. Buerger Allen exercise is the form of exercise technique performed

with the help of an exercise board in both foot about 10- 15 minutes for three to

four times in a day was found to be effective in promoting wound healing

process among diabetic patients. Hence in improving lower extremity perfusion

to promote wound healing process for diabetic foot ulcer, the practice of

Buerger Allen exercise can be intervened to impose comfort and faster wound

healing.

Diabetic foot ulcers are the sores that occur on the feet of the people with

Type 1 and Type 2 diabetes mellitus. Diabetic foot ulcer is defined as major

erosions of the epithelium that extends into the dermis and deeper tissues and

are associated with reduced healing capacity (Kinmond – 2003). Diabetic foot

ulcer is a miserable experience. The daily activities of the individual and family

inevitably revolve around the ulcer; it can affect employment, earning capacity,

social life, relationships and quality of life. It is no wonder that people with

diabetic foot complications are more at risk of depression.

The two main risk factors that causes diabetic foot ulcer are peripheral

neuropathy and micro as well as macro vascular ischemia. Peripheral

neuropathy causes loss of pain or feeling into the toes, legs and arms due to the

distal nerve damage and low blood flow supply (arthrosclerosis), very less

oxygen supply, and eventually death of tissue in feet occurs. Based upon

Diabetic foot society of India (2010), about 84% of all lower limb amputations

are preceded by foot ulcers in diabetic clients and every single day 110 Indians

have a foot or part of their leg got amputated due to diabetic foot ulcer.

Jamie d. Santilli, (1999), found Chronic critical limb ischemia is

manifested by pain at rest, nonhealing wounds and gangrene. Ischemic rest pain

is typically described as a burning pain in the arch or distal foot that occurs

while the patient is recumbent but is relieved when the patient returns to a

position in which the feet are dependent. Objective hemodynamic parameters

that support the diagnosis of critical limb ischemia include an ankle-brachial

Page 29: “A STUDY TO ASSESS THE EFFECTIVENESS OF BUERGER ALLEN …repository-tnmgrmu.ac.in/9541/1/300116314vijaya_barathi.pdf · 2018-09-13 · four times in a day was found to be effective

16

index of 0.4 or less, an ankle systolic pressure of 50 mm Hg or less, or a toe

systolic pressure of 30 mm Hg or less. Intervention may include conservative

therapy, revascularization or amputation. Progressive gangrene, rapidly

enlarging wounds or continuous ischemic rest pain can signify a threat to the

limb and suggest the need for revascularization in patients without prohibitive

operative risks. Bypass grafts are usually required because of the multilevel and

distal nature of the arterial narrowing in critical limb ischemia. Patients with

diabetes are more likely than other patients to have distal disease that is less

amenable to bypass grafting. Compared with amputation, revascularization is

more cost-effective and is associated with better perioperative morbidity and

mortality. Limb preservation should be the goal in most patients with critical

limb ischemia.

John Wiley, (2001), said that foot ulcers are a serious complication of

diabetes mellitus that are associated with adverse sequelae and high costs. In

addition, such foot ulcers have a significant impact on quality of life (QoL). For

example, the loss of mobility associated with foot ulcers affects patients' ability

to perform simple, everyday tasks and to participate in leisure activities.

Notably, several studies have shown that patients with diabetes mellitus and

foot ulcers were more depressed and had poorer QoL than those who had no

diabetic complications. Given the detrimental effect foot ulcers have on

patients, it is essential that these foot ulcers are prevented or treated more

effectively than at present. Evidence suggests that many foot ulcers can be

prevented by using intensive interventions and adopting a multidisciplinary

approach to treatment. In addition, preventative strategies may become more

effective if new research into how patients with diabetes experience and

interpret their health threats (e.g. diagnosis „loss of sensation‟ or a foot ulcer

episode) is taken into account. With regard to treatment, new options should

enable ulcers to heal more quickly than with standard therapies. One area of

interest is the use of growth factors. For example, recombinant platelet-derived

Page 36: “A STUDY TO ASSESS THE EFFECTIVENESS OF BUERGER ALLEN …repository-tnmgrmu.ac.in/9541/1/300116314vijaya_barathi.pdf · 2018-09-13 · four times in a day was found to be effective

23

growth factor, in addition to good ulcer care, has been shown to improve the

number of ulcers that heal and healing times significantly compared with good

ulcer care alone. Other potential new treatments include the use of skin

substitutes. In summary, improved preventative measures and wound treatment

should reduce the potential for patients with diabetes mellitus to experience

impaired QoL caused by foot ulcers.

Wagner wound assessment scale

1. Open lesions: may have deformity or cellulitis - 0

2. Superficial ulcer - 1

3. Deep ulcer to tendon or joint capsule - 2

4. Deep ulcer with abscess, osteomyelitis, or joint sepsis - 3

5. Local gangrene – forefoot or heel - 4

6. Extensive gangrene, needs major amputation - 5

BUERGER ALLEN EXERCISE

The feet are easily accessible and require no repositioning. While exercising,

the nurse can assess the feet, stimulate circulation, decrease pain, provide a local form

of passive exercise and promote lower extremity perfusion. Through this therapy

patients receive attention and touch, which are vital elements of care that promote

comfort and well-being. Buerger Allen exercise is the one through which the lower

extremity perfusion can be improved, whereby it is used to promote the wound

healing process.

Definition:

Exercise:

Exercise is physical activity that is planned, structured, and repetitive for the

purpose of conditioning any part of the body. Exercise is used to improve

health, maintain fitness and is important as a means of physical rehabilitation.

Buerger Allen exercise:

Specific exercises intended to improve circulation to the feet and legs.

Exercises used to empty engorged vessels, stimulate circulation, and at least

partially relieve swelling (oedema) in patients with insufficiency of circulation

to the lower limbs and feet.

Purposes:

Reduces pain

Promotes circulation

Improves wound healing process

Promotes relaxation

Reduces anxiety and depression

Decreases the need of medications

Procedure:

1. Select the subject according to the Wagner wound assessment scale (within the

range of 0 to 1). Assess the condition of the foot ulcer.

2. Explain the procedure.

3. Provide privacy.

4. Make the sample to lie down in a comfortable position.

5. Keep the Buerger Allen exercise board on the cot.

6. Elevate the lower extremities to an angle of 450

to 900 with the help of exercise

board. Provide support to the lower extremities to maintain the position.

7. Make the subject to maintain the same position in the same manner until the skin

blanches (appears dead white).

8. Lower the feet and the legs below the level of the rest of the body until redness

appears (care should be taken that there is no pressure against the back of the knees).

9. Place the legs flat on the bed for a few minutes. Ask the subjects to sit in a

relaxed position while each foot is flexed and extended then inverted and everted for

3 minutes till the feet turns entirely pink. Ask the subject to rotate the feet in all the

direction.

10. Make the subject to lie quietly for 5 minutes, keeping legs warm with a blanket.

Note:

The length of time for each position varies with the subject's tolerance and the

speed with which color change occurs. Usually the exercises are prescribed so that the

legs are elevated for 2 to 3 minutes, down 5 to 10 minutes and then flat on the bed for

10 minutes. If the feet are blue or painful, elevate them and relax as necessary. Repeat

the procedure for three to four times in a day.
